MYRUN, a documentary on Terry Hitchcock, a guy who after the death of his wife to breast cancer ran 75 marathons in 75 days to raise awareness to the issues facing single parents, is showing one day only in theaters March 31st.
The movie is narrated by Academy Award Winner Billy Bob Thornton.
